EP 100: Celebrating 100! Resharing Memorable Moments – A Good Kind of Scary
On this week's podcast we celebrate 100 episodes by reflecting on the journey this podcast has been on since day 1. I enjoyed listening back over certain conversations that stuck with me and getting to share snippets of different guest speakers throughout this episode. Listen in to get a good overview of what the podcast has become and how it's impacted my life. Thanks to everyone who has supported the show! Stay tuned.
Points of discussion:
- One of my biggest fears (public speaking) and how I grew more confident in my abilities.
- Physical changes when feeling nervous: reddening, stuttering, heart racing & why they are normal.
- Secondary school: ducking the head down during readings, running to the toilet & avoiding speaking out.
- Cultural differences with vocalizing opinions.
- Liking the sound of your voice vs Expressing an opinion.
- Studying at university in Ireland vs Studying in America.
- Are children overly praised nowadays and is it a good thing?
- Have we normalized using alcohol as a social crutch / confidence booster?
- What teaching high school students taught me about public speaking.
